Abstract

The invention relates to an image denoising processing method and apparatus. The method comprises the steps of receiving a shooting instruction; performing continuous shooting according to the shooting instruction to obtain multiple frames of original images; obtaining an environmental brightness value and/or an ISO value corresponding to a shooting environment; judging whether one of at least following conditions is met: the environmental brightness value is smaller than or equal to a preset brightness value, and the ISO value is greater than or equal to a preset ISO value; if yes, obtaining a to-be-denoised original image according to the environmental brightness value or the ISO value; and obtaining RAW data of the to-be-denoised original image, converting the RAW data into YUV data, and performing multi-frame denoising processing on the YUV data to obtain an output image. With the adoption of the method, a clear image can be obtained without manually adjusting exposure time or brightness gain in an automatic shooting mode.

Description

technical field [0001] The present invention relates to the technical field of image processing, in particular to an image noise reduction processing method and device. Background technique [0002] With the development of technology, digital cameras have spread, and mobile terminals such as smartphones and tablet PCs also have shooting functions. In the fully automatic shooting mode, in order to meet the brightness requirements of the picture in a low-light environment, long exposure or high brightness gain is usually used to achieve it. The long exposure method can make the picture pure, but as the exposure time increases, if there is a slight shake when taking pictures, the picture will be blurred. The way of high brightness gain will be accompanied by serious noise, which makes the picture have obvious graininess. How to obtain a clear image without manually adjusting the exposure time or brightness gain has become a technical problem that needs to be solved at present...
